Adjusting LCD monitor/viewfinder
ª
Adjusting the brightness and colour 
level
1
Set [SETUP] >> [LCD SET] or [EVF SET] >> 
[YES].
2
Move the joystick up or down in order to 
select the item to be adjusted.
[LCD SET]
:
Brightness of the LCD monitor
:
Colour level of the LCD monitor
[EVF SET]
:
Brightness of the viewfinder
3
Move the joystick left or right to move the 
bar indication representing the brightness.
4
Press the [MENU] button or the joystick to 
complete the settings.
≥When the LCD monitor is rotated by 180° 
towards the lens, the brightness of the LCD 
monitor cannot be adjusted.
≥To adjust the brightness of the viewfinder, close 
the LCD monitor and extend the viewfinder to 
activate it.
≥These settings will not affect the images actually 
recorded.
Recording with the built-in LED 
video light
1
Press the [LIGHT] button. 
≥The [
] indication appears on the LCD 
monitor.
ª
To cancel the built-in LED video light
Press the [LIGHT] button again. 
≥The subject should be within 1.5 metres of the 
movie camera.
≥Using the LED video light reduces battery time.
≥Set the LED video light to off when not in use.
≥Do not look directly into the light.
≥Using the colour night view function at the same 
time will make conditions even brighter.
≥The LED video light enables simply lightening 
the images taken in a dimly-lit place. We also 
recommend using it in a bright place to obtain 
high quality images.
